Our Approach

From assessment to instruction to support at home, every part of the process is designed with your child in mind.

Using a structured and multi-sensory Orton-Gillingham approach, each in-person or online session is tailored to your child's needs and interests to build strong, lasting reading and writing K-12 skills. Along the way, we focus on nurturing confidence, self-advocacy, and a positive sense of themselves as a learner. We also offer writing specific or executive functioning support.

As part of your child's plan, we can also offer Level B in-depth assessment. When combined with school documentation, parent input, and other relevant information, we get a clear, well-rounded picture of your child's reading and writing strengths and areas for growth. It's a valuable starting point that leads to an insightful plan and a clear baseline to celebrate progress as your child moves forward.

Not sure how to support your child's literacy at home, or how to navigate an Individual Education Plan (IEP)? We can walk through strategies to help you collaborate with your child's school on goals and accommodations. If you like, your child can join too; we'll create a child-friendly version of their IEP so they can be part of and understand their own plan.
